My Bio

A REALTOR® since 2012, Clint spent even more time honing his real estate skills with over 20 years of home construction, maintenance, and inspection experience. He has insight into the structural and functional aspects of homes, making him a unique partner to help with all his clients real estate needs.

He is a life-long resident of Central Ohio and continues to live here with his wife and two girls. He serves on the board of a local youth athletic association and gives back to his community in numerous ways.

FAQs
How do I start the process of buying a home?

he first step is to assess your financial situation and get pre-approved for a mortgage. Then, you can start searching for properties within your budget and engage the services of a real estate agent to guide you through the process.

What is the difference between pre-qualification and pre-approval?

Pre-qualification is an initial assessment based on the information you provide to a lender, giving you an estimate of how much you could potentially borrow. Pre-approval, on the other hand, involves a more comprehensive evaluation of your financial background, credit history, and documentation, providing a conditional commitment for a specific loan amount.

How long does it typically take to close on a house?

The closing process can vary, but it usually takes around 30 to 45 days from the time your offer is accepted to the closing date. This timeframe allows for various tasks such as inspections, appraisal, loan processing, and finalizing the necessary paperwork.

What is a home inspection, and is it necessary?

A home inspection is a thorough examination of a property's condition, typically conducted by a professional inspector. It is highly recommended as it helps identify any underlying issues or potential problems with the home, allowing buyers to make informed decisions and negotiate repairs or adjustments if needed.

How much do I need for a down payment on a house?

The down payment amount can vary depending on several factors, including the type of loan and your lender's requirements. In general, down payments range from 3% to 20% of the home's purchase price. However, it's advisable to strive for a higher down payment to potentially secure a better interest rate and reduce monthly mortgage payments.

Should I work with a real estate agent when buying a home?

While it's not mandatory, working with a real estate agent can be highly beneficial. They have extensive knowledge of the market, access to listings, and can help negotiate on your behalf. They also guide you through the paperwork, coordinate inspections, and provide valuable advice throughout the home buying process.

How do I determine the fair market value of a property?

The fair market value is usually determined through a comparative market analysis (CMA) conducted by a real estate agent. It involves assessing similar recently sold properties in the same area, considering factors like location, size, condition, and market trends. Appraisals can also be done by certified professionals to determine the property's value.

What are closing costs, and who pays them?

Closing costs are various fees associated with the purchase of a home, including lender fees, title insurance, attorney fees, and property taxes. Both buyers and sellers typically have closing costs, but the specific allocation can be negotiated as part of the purchase agreement.

Can I back out of a home purchase agreement?

It depends on the terms and contingencies in the purchase agreement. Common contingencies, such as financing, home inspection, or appraisal contingencies, allow buyers to cancel the agreement within a specified timeframe if certain conditions are not met. However, it's important to review the contract and consult with a real estate professional to understand your rights and any potential consequences.

What is a homeowners association (HOA), and what should I know about it?

A homeowners association is an organization that manages and enforces rules within a residential community or condominium complex. They typically charge fees for maintenance, amenities, and community services.
